Currently got a 8" Rize Lift with 38's. not big enough haha...ready for bigger.
Im looking at options other than a body lift which may be my only option
is there any shackle lifts i can put on with this rize kit or get some custom drop shackles for the rear end? Then im stuck with what i need to do to lift the front....probably only option are king coilovers.

yeah i've seen some lift shackles for our trucks but i don't remember where. supposed to lift like 2in.s or so. you could either run a leveling kit spacer or some new coilovers and crank them up to fit the 40's. there was a guy on here awhile back that had only a 9in lift, 6in. sus./3in. bl, and he had 40s with no rubbing. you just need to have the right backspacing and you should be able to run them with 10in.s of lift no problem.
ebay i think is where the shackles are at. PM chaz he has them on his truck.
as for the front, need to bump it to 10-10.5 inches and probly will have a little rubbing depending on your tire width and wheel backspacing.
eff one fitty was running 40s with 11" with some trimming. he was (6" lift + cranked coilovers) 8" suspension and 3 body.
